A. INSTALLATION PANEL/CEILING/ INTERIOR WALL MOUNTING Cut a 107mm diameter hole for 100mm fans or a 130mm hole for 125mm fans. Remove the tile front by rotating counter clockwise. Loosen the 3 grille screws to remove inner grille. Mark the screw centres through the holes in the fan back plate. Drill, plug and screw into position.

Speed Selection The trickle flow rate can be quickly adjusted via the dial as shown – either with the inner grille on or off (see below images). The 10-100% scale relates to a flow rate of between 5-16l/s. The scale is adjusted based on the installation type (SW1). The boost speed is proportionally higher than the trickle flow rate.
Inbuilt Threshold Humidistat with Rapid Rise Detection (HT models only) The HT models include a digital humidity sensor with pre-set Threshold and Rapid Rise sensing. The settings are fixed and cannot be adjusted. Threshold: The fan will increase in speed proportionally between trickle and boost flow rates at 75%RH and 85%RH.

Quick Setup 1) Set the installation type – wall or ducted Trickle Speed (SW1) Dial 2) Set trickle flow rate – Dial as shown in the table below. Humidity models: The humidity sensor is fully SW1 / SW2 automatic and does not require setting. Boost speed is fixed at 50% higher than the set trickle rate.
